What is the hybridization of the carbon atoms in 1,3-butadiene, h2c=ch-ch=ch2?

the 1,3- butadiene is h2c=ch-ch=ch2, so we have

sp² sp² sp² sp²
h2c = ch - ch = ch2

the hybridization of the carbon atoms is sp² : trigonal planar
